Output f73f37437fb5514079fc6fc0a4ee51e9f766638ae62d5a3d237a87b9605d974e:17

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5948e870370adf54ee4dee5dbc20267846bfbb4 OP_EQUAL
address
3GnXP6j9u6ViEJqzeqrWziYmmJNKgmR32e
transaction
f73f37437fb5514079fc6fc0a4ee51e9f766638ae62d5a3d237a87b9605d974e
confirmations
303722
spent
true